Output 9d86262665332474a673c0fae6b352a8ff2f2a57b782d553492d87f59bfc72ab:1

value
623778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f1652368d93d3eff5b04b71b5d13ef27cb00f8a OP_EQUAL
address
3GCC6wmfWmQCh8hMiSK33NyxUVKaxvf2EH
transaction
9d86262665332474a673c0fae6b352a8ff2f2a57b782d553492d87f59bfc72ab
spent
true